Transaction 39b10d38b06c954c3163ab90fb91c477b85586ad4c836b778ed3f1ced4136f63

2 Input
2 Outputs
  • 39b10d38b06c954c3163ab90fb91c477b85586ad4c836b778ed3f1ced4136f63:0
  • value  2007988000
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 39b10d38b06c954c3163ab90fb91c477b85586ad4c836b778ed3f1ced4136f63:1
  • value  657285567
    address  33g6HbESkeuuAsabH6HRTxxcQoacUzYH3X